History & Origin

Laure is the French form of Laura, from Latin 'laurel,' the victor's crown. In America it crested around 1959 and remained uncommon next to Laura (said 'LOR').

It peaked in the late 1950s and stayed rare. A spare, elegant French classic.

Did you know? Laure is the French form of Laura ('laurel'). Trim and elegant, it saw quiet American use peaking around 1959, carried by families with French ties, then stayed rare beside Laura and Laurie (said 'LOR').
